To Be Honest is a social media abbreviation
The acronym “TBH” stands for “To Be Honest.” Teenagers post them for several reasons, from connecting with a crush to gaining more likes. Sometimes, they’re posted just to make people laugh or simply to get a response. However, most of these tubes are between friends, or at least within two degrees of friendship.
